摘要
Realtek ALC4082 和 ALC5686 同属 Realtek ALC 系列 USB 音频 Codec,但目标场景截然不同:ALC4082 定位高解析音乐播放与专业录音,ALC5686 则主打语音通信与消费级 Type-C 音频模组。本文从关键参数、典型应用、选型建议三个维度对两款芯片进行横向对比,帮助硬件工程师快速判断哪颗芯片更适合自己的产品。
核心结论:追求 384kHz/32bit 高解析音质与 ASIO 极低延迟,优先选 ALC4082;专注 Type-C 有线耳机、语音通话、或需要防砖块(Anti-Bricking)保护的设备,则 ALC5686 更合适。
1. 基本定位对比
| 参数 | ALC4082 | ALC5686 |
|---|---|---|
| USB 标准 | USB 2.0 Full Speed / High Speed | USB 2.0 High Speed |
| 采样率 | 最高 384kHz(PCM) | 最高 96kHz(PCM) |
| 位深 | 最高 32-bit | 最高 24-bit |
| DAC 动态范围 | 130 dB(参考官方数据手册) | 106 dB(参考官方数据手册) |
| ADC 动态范围 | 123 dB(参考官方数据手册) | 98 dB(参考官方数据手册) |
| 封装 | QFN-68 | QFN-40 |
| 供电 | 3.3V AVDD / 1.8V DVDD | 3.3V |
| 目标场景 | Hi-Fi 播放器、专业声卡、母带监听 | Type-C 有线耳机、语音模组、游戏耳机 |
| 内置DSP | 有(语音预处理) | 有(回声消除、噪声抑制) |
| I2S 接口 | 支持(主/从模式) | 支持(主/从模式) |
2. ALC4082:高清音频旗舰
2.1 规格亮点
ALC4082 是 Realtek 面向高阶音频市场推出的 USB Codec,核心卖点是极高的 DAC/ADC 动态范围。130dB 的 DAC 动态范围意味着底噪极低,适合监听级设备与专业录音场景。384kHz 采样率覆盖了 DSD512 以上的升频需求(通过 DSD over PCM 方式),远超 CD 音质(44.1kHz)与普通 Hi-Res 标准(96kHz/24bit)。
支持 ASIO 2.3 驱动是 ALC4082 的另一重要特性。ASIO 协议可绕过 Windows KMixer 音频层,实现端到端极低延迟(通常 5–10ms 以内),是音乐制作人与游戏音效设计师的核心需求。
2.2 典型应用场景
- USB 外置声卡:高解析 DAC 解码耳放
- 专业录音接口:吉他声卡、直播机架
- 母带监听设备:对动态范围要求极高的监听音箱系统
- 游戏声卡:追求精准空间音频定位的硬核游戏玩家设备
2.3 注意事项
ALC4082 的 QFN-68 封装对 PCB 布局提出较高要求,模拟电路部分需要独立分区与地铺铜,以防止数字开关噪声耦合进模拟信号链。参考官方数据手册确认推荐走线宽度与铺铜禁区。
3. ALC5686:语音 Codec 专家
3.1 规格亮点
ALC5686 的设计目标并非高解析音乐,而是为语音场景提供一站式解决方案。内置 DSP 支持回声消除(AEC)、动态噪声抑制(DNS)和自动增益控制(AGC),这三项功能在实时语音通信中几乎必不可少。高阶版本还引入了 Anti-Bricking 保护机制,可在 USB 枚举失败或固件异常时自动恢复,防止设备变砖。
96kHz/24bit 的音频带宽对语音通信(带宽需求通常 8–16kHz)已属过剩,剩余的 DSP 算力可用于 ENC(Environmental Noise Cancellation)降噪算法。
3.2 典型应用场景
- Type-C 有线耳机:ANC 主动降噪耳机有线模式
- 游戏耳机麦克风:带语音降噪的游戏耳机
- 视频会议设备:USB 会议麦克风、摄像头音频模块
- IoT 语音交互模组:智能音箱语音采集前端
3.3 Anti-Bricking 特性详解
ALC5686 内置的 Anti-Bricking 机制是其区别于其他语音 Codec 的标志性特性。传统 USB Audio 设备在固件刷坏或 USB 枚举异常时,主控无法重新识别设备,用户只能手动进入 DFU 模式恢复。ALC5686 在检测到异常后会主动切换到应急 Bootloader 模式,等待主机重新枚举,从而实现自动恢复,无需用户干预。
4. 应用场景选型对照
| 需求场景 | 推荐芯片 | 原因 |
|---|---|---|
| 音乐制作/Hi-Fi 听歌 | ALC4082 | 384kHz/32bit、130dB 动态范围、ASIO 支持 |
| 专业录音接口 | ALC4082 | 高动态、低延迟、DSD 支持 |
| Type-C 有线耳机 | ALC5686 | 语音 DSP 集成、Anti-Bricking、低功耗 |
| 游戏耳机麦克风 | ALC5686 | AEC/ENC/AGC DSP、通话降噪 |
| 视频会议设备 | ALC5686 | 远场拾音优化、USB 即插即用 |
| 成本敏感语音模组 | ALC5686 | 更高集成度、更小封装、更低 BOM 成本 |
5. 硬件设计差异
5.1 外围电路
ALC4082 需要外部晶振(通常 12.288MHz),模拟电源需要 LDO 单独供电,建议使用低噪声射频 LDO(如 Azoteq Janus 或 TI TPS7A47 系列)以保护动态范围指标。
ALC5686 可选外部晶振或使用内部 PLL 生成时钟,降低了 BOM 成本;但若需要精确采样率(如 48kHz 倍数),仍建议外接晶振。
5.2 I2S/TDM 接口
两款芯片均支持 I2S 标准接口与 TDM(Time Division Multiplexing)多声道模式。ALC4082 在 TDM 模式下最多支持 8 声道输出,适合多扬声器系统;ALC5686 在 TDM 模式下通常支持 2 声道立体声输出。
6. 驱动与系统兼容
| 维度 | ALC4082 | ALC5686 |
|---|---|---|
| Windows UAC2.0 驱动 | 原生支持(通用驱动) | 原生支持(通用驱动) |
| ASIO 驱动 | 官方提供 | 官方提供(部分版本) |
| macOS | 原生支持 | 原生支持 |
| Linux (ALSA) | 需要额外配置 | 原生支持 |
| 游戏主机 (PS5/Switch) | 部分支持 | 支持(UAC1.0 兼容模式) |
7. 常见问题 FAQ
Q1:ALC4082 能直接替代 ALC5686 用于语音场景吗?
技术上可以,但不推荐。ALC4082 成本更高、功耗更大(参考官方数据手册),且其 DSP 优化方向是音质而非语音降噪。语音场景选 ALC5686 性价比更高。
Q2:ALC5686 的 Anti-Bricking 功能是否需要额外配置?
不需要。Anti-Bricking 是芯片内置的硬件机制,固件自动启用,无需主控配置寄存器。但刷写固件时仍建议通过官方工具并确保供电稳定。
Q3:两款芯片是否支持 USB Audio Class 3.0?
ALC4082 支持 UAC3.0;ALC5686 主要面向 UAC2.0 设备,部分版本可通过固件升级支持 UAC3.0(参考官方数据手册确认具体型号)。
Q4:PCB 布局上两者有何共同注意点?
均需将 USB D+/D- 差分走线控制在 90Ω 阻抗,模拟区域与数字区域保持适当隔离,晶振下方禁止走高速信号线。
8. 结论
ALC4082 与 ALC5686 代表了 Realtek 在 USB 音频 Codec 领域的两条技术路线:前者追求极致音质与动态范围,适合高解析音频与专业录音场景;后者专注语音通信全链路优化,以高集成度和可靠性占领消费级市场。
选型时应以应用场景为第一判断依据——音乐品质优先选 4082,语音通信优先选 5686。两者在各自细分领域均具备原厂驱动完善、生态成熟的优势,是目前 USB 音频模组设计中最为可靠的方案之一。
注:本文规格参数以 Realtek 官方数据手册为参考,不同版本固件或封装可能存在差异,设计前请以对应型号最新 datasheet 为准。